L4D2 pre-order demo out Oct. 27, public demo Nov. 3

Remember when Valve announced that the Left 4 Dead 2 demo would launch on October 27th? It turns out that date is actually the early access date for those who pre-order the game on Xbox 360 or PC (via Steam). Starting November 3rd, the demo will be available to all PC players and Xbox Live Gold subscribers. Xbox Live Silver members, as usual, will have to wait an additional week to demo the game on November 10th. Then again, if you only have a Silver account, you probably aren't too excited for a predominantly multiplayer game anyway.

The Left 4 Dead 2 demo will allow up to four players the opportunity to survive "The Parish" campaign. The PC version will be playable online or through a local network, while the Xbox version will feature the same options -- plus two-player split screen. Valve notes that the demo includes "all the new boss infected zombies and all the new melee weapons." So, please, do yourself a favor: grab a katana and start cutting fools down.
